[發(fā)明專利]一種基于SD卡的嵌入式設備全自動固件燒寫方法有效
| 申請?zhí)枺?/td> | 201510024496.0 | 申請日: | 2015-01-16 |
| 公開(公告)號: | CN104965725B | 公開(公告)日: | 2018-06-08 |
| 發(fā)明(設計)人: | 柴亮 | 申請(專利權(quán))人: | 北京中電興發(fā)科技有限公司 |
| 主分類號: | G06F9/445 | 分類號: | G06F9/445 |
| 代理公司: | 北京慶峰財智知識產(chǎn)權(quán)代理事務所(普通合伙) 11417 | 代理人: | 李文軍 |
| 地址: | 100095 北京市海淀區(qū)*** | 國省代碼: | 北京;11 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 燒寫 嵌入式設備 引導加載器 寫入 分區(qū) 指示燈閃爍 嵌入式ARM 定制磁盤 生產(chǎn)效率 統(tǒng)一存儲 自行啟動 電腦 提示 制作 | ||
1.一種基于SD卡的嵌入式設備全自動固件燒寫方法,其特征在于,包括如下步驟:
S1、定制具有全自動燒寫功能的引導加載器;
S2、將引導加載器和待燒寫固件統(tǒng)一存入電腦;
S3、將SD卡插入電腦,為SD卡定制磁盤分區(qū);刪除SD卡已有分區(qū);新建兩個分區(qū)sdb1、sdb2;將sdb1格式化為vfat文件系統(tǒng),作為引導加載器和待燒寫固件的存儲區(qū);
S4、將上述引導加載器和待燒寫固件寫入SD卡的相應分區(qū),制作出具有固件自動燒寫功能的SD卡;
S5、將SD卡插入嵌入式設備,引導加載器自行啟動,將所有待燒寫固件寫入嵌入式設備;
S6、引導加載器控制嵌入式設備提示固件燒寫完成;
S1包括如下步驟:
1)、獲取引導加載器原始文件;
2)、為引導加載器添加閃存壞塊檢測與跳過處理功能;擦除閃存中的每一個塊,如果擦除失敗,則判定該塊為一個壞塊,記錄閃存中所有的壞塊,在燒寫固件程序時,直接跳過壞塊進行燒寫;
3)、為引導加載器增加初始化設置與固件自動燒寫功能,在燒寫固件程序時,直接跳過壞塊進行燒寫;
4)、為引導加載器增加燒寫完畢自動提示功能;
5)、生成可執(zhí)行的引導加載器文件。
2.根據(jù)權(quán)利要求1所述的一種基于SD卡的嵌入式設備全自動固件燒寫方法,其特征在于,使用自動處理腳本統(tǒng)一完成S3、S4。
3.根據(jù)權(quán)利要求2中所述的一種基于SD卡的嵌入式設備全自動固件燒寫方法,其特征在于,自動處理腳本根據(jù)不同型號嵌入式設備燒寫不同固件。
4.根據(jù)權(quán)利要求1-3中任意一項所述的一種基于SD卡的嵌入式設備全自動固件燒寫方法,其特征在于,S6中引導加載器控制嵌入式設備通過指示燈一直閃爍來提示固件燒寫完成,
引導加載器設置死循環(huán),當燒寫完成后,由該死循環(huán)向嵌入式設備IO口不間斷地輸出控制命令,使嵌入式設備上的指示燈一直閃爍。
5.根據(jù)權(quán)利要求4所述的一種基于SD卡的嵌入式設備全自動固件燒寫方法,其特征在于,S2中所述待燒寫固件為uboot、kernel和fi lesys。
該專利技術資料僅供研究查看技術是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于北京中電興發(fā)科技有限公司,未經(jīng)北京中電興發(fā)科技有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201510024496.0/1.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 上一篇:一種連續(xù)升級的方法及裝置
- 下一篇:一種除法器





